package hash

import "github.com/centrifuge/go-substrate-rpc-client/v4/hash"

Index

Functions

func NewBlake2b128

func NewBlake2b128(k []byte) (hash.Hash, error)

NewBlake2b128 returns blake2b-128 hasher

func NewBlake2b128Concat

func NewBlake2b128Concat(k []byte) (hash.Hash, error)

NewBlake2b128Concat returns an instance of blake2b concat hasher

func NewBlake2b256

func NewBlake2b256(k []byte) (hash.Hash, error)

NewBlake2b256 returns blake2b-256 hasher

func NewBlake2b512

func NewBlake2b512(k []byte) (hash.Hash, error)

NewBlake2b512 returns blake2b-512 hasher

func NewIdentity

func NewIdentity(b []byte) hash.Hash

Source Files

blake2b.go identity.go

Version
v4.2.1 (latest)
Published
Dec 5, 2023
Platform
linux/amd64
Imports
2 packages
Last checked
1 week ago

Tools for package owners.